Arjun, Arshad are much younger at heart-Jackky Bhagnani

Jackky Bhagnani talks about the camaraderie he shares with the co-stars of his next film
Seema Sinha (BOMBAY TIMES; October 19, 2012)
Jackky Bhagnani, who will be seen with Arjun Rampal and Arshad Warsi in the forthcoming film Ajab Gazabb Love, says he shares a special camaraderie with both the actors, with whom he has worked in earlier films too. “I won’t suddenly put my arm around Arjun and Arshad and say ‘wassup’? I respect them, yet they great pals of mine. They are the real rockstars and much younger at heart,” he says.
Arjun had played the lead in Jackky’s dad Vashu Bhagnani’s Deewanapan (2001), a film on which Jackky had assisted. Since then, the two share a special bond. Says Arjun, “I had seen Jackky when he weighed 140 kilos. He was shy and conscious, and I’d often tell him to lose weight. When I met him again after a year, I was surprised to see a changed person. He had shed 50 kilos and had transformed into a confident young man.”
Adds Jackky, “We drive people crazy with our pranks. Since our off-screen comic timing is so good, it also reflects in the film. I should learn to party like Arjun though.” On Arshad, with whom he has worked in F.A.L.T.U, Jackky says, “I call him Arshad Sir since I’d called him ‘sir’ the first time we’d met. I am stuck with it but we are great buddies. I seek advice from him, and even talk to him if I’m upset about something. He has promised to direct me some day.”
Ajab Gazabb Love, produced by Puja Films, releases October 24.
